How much do timeshares cost

There are many expenses to shared vacation living that are often glossed over by the salespeople.  What are your maintenance fees each month and how are they billed.  Will you have to pay housekeeping fees each time you stay?   Does the location(s) where your timeshare is located consider it a hotel and levy a tax on you each time you stay.  Until you have paid off your shares you will have a monthly charge for your timeshares.  Make sure if you finance it,  that the interest rate is fixed and will not go up on you.   Know what it will cost before you spend more than can afford.
